The best way to save money when buying or selling US dollars is to stay informed. Understanding the influence of the global economy on exchange rates is a good place to start. When looking for the best exchange rate in Thunder Bay you must understand that the rates you see are constantly fluctuating. What you see in the morning can be very different from what you see later on in the day. Therefore securing a rate you are comfortable with can sometimes be challenging. You must also know that the rate that you see listed on the TV or online is not the rate which you will ever be given. This rate is known as the “spot rate” or “inter-bank rate”. It is essentially the rate that banks will sell to one another, and is usually in the millions of dollars. It is therefore very unlikely, that you will ever be receiving this rate. Instead, what you will receive is a marked up rate. Typical markups range between 2-5% depending on the currency you are looking for.
Now that you know this valuable information, you must seek a way to find where you can exchange your funds for the lowest mark-up possible.

About Thunder Bay
Thunder Bay, which derives its name from the prodigious Thunder Bay at the Head of Lake Superior, is the most densely inhabited municipality in Northwestern Ontario. After originally being established as a fur trading hub by the French in the late 17th century, Thunder Bay evolved over the subsequent decades to become one of Canada’s most important shipping hubs, as the city became a link between eastern and western Canada. Today, Thunder Bay has grown to a population eclipsing 100,000 inhabitants.
Despite its origins in forestry and manufacturing, Thunder Bay has evolved into the services hub of Northwestern Ontario. Thunder Bay’s largest tourist attraction is Fort William Historical Park, which is a reconstruction of a trading post as it was in 1815. Due to Thunder Bay’s proximity to the wilderness, the city is near a multitude of conservatories and national parks. Education also features saliently in Thunder Bay, as the city is home to both Lakehead University and Confederation College.
